详解springboot的三种启动方式
Spring Boot 启动方式详解 Spring Boot 作为当前最流行的 Java 框架之一,提供了多种灵活的启动方式,满足不同场景下的需求。在本文中,我们将详细介绍 Spring Boot 的三种启动方式,并对每种方式进行详细解释。 第一种启动方式:IDE 运行 IDE(Integrated Development Environment,集成开发环境)是开发者日常使用的主要工具之一。使用 IDE 运行 Spring Boot 项目,可以快速验证和 debug 项目。在 IDE 中,开发者可以轻松地设置断点、单步执行代码、查看变量值等,提高开发效率。 要使用 IDE 运行 Spring Boot 项目,需要在 IDE 中创建一个新的 Spring Boot 项目,然后在项目的主类中添加一个 main 方法,这个方法将作为项目的入口点。例如,在 Eclipse 中,可以创建一个新的 Spring Boot 项目,然后在 src/main/java 目录下创建一个新的 Java 类,例如 `Application.java`,然后在其中添加一个 main 方法: ```java @SpringBootApplication public class Application { public static void main(String[] args) { SpringApplication.run(Application.class, args); } } ``` 然后,在 IDE 中运行这个类的 main 方法,即可启动 Spring Boot 项目。 第二种启动方式:使用 Maven 运行 Maven 是一个流行的构建工具,提供了许多便捷的功能,例如依赖管理、编译、打包等。在 Spring Boot 项目中,可以使用 Maven 来运行项目。要使用 Maven 运行 Spring Boot 项目,需要在项目的根目录下执行以下命令: ``` mvn spring-boot:run ``` 这将启动 Spring Boot 项目,项目将在开发环境中运行。 第三种启动方式:使用 jar 文件运行 使用 jar 文件运行 Spring Boot 项目,这是一种常见的部署方式。在 Spring Boot 项目中,可以使用 Maven 或 Gradle 等构建工具来生成 jar 文件。然后,可以使用以下命令来运行 jar 文件: ``` java -jar xxx.jar ``` 其中,`xxx.jar` 是生成的 jar 文件名。 在使用 jar 文件运行 Spring Boot 项目时,需要确保项目的依赖项已经被正确地配置好了,否则可能会出现依赖项缺失的问题。 Spring Boot 提供了多种灵活的启动方式,满足不同场景下的需求。开发者可以根据自己的需求选择合适的启动方式,以提高开发效率和项目的可维护性。 此外,在 Spring Boot 项目中,还可以使用其他的启动方式,例如使用 Docker 容器来运行项目,或者使用云平台来部署项目。这些方式都可以满足不同场景下的需求,提高项目的灵活性和可扩展性。
- 粉丝: 6
- 资源: 917
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 冒泡排序算法详解及Java与Python实现
- 字幕网页文字检测20-YOLO(v5至v11)、COCO、CreateML、Paligemma、TFRecord、VOC数据集合集.rar
- FastAdmin后台框架开源且可以免费商用,一键生成CRUD, 一款基于ThinkPHP和Bootstrap的极速后台开发框架,基于Auth验证的权限管理系统,一键生成 CRUD,自动生成控制器等
- IMG_4525.jpg
- 基于 Spring Cloud 的一个分布式系统套件的整合 具备 JeeSite4 单机版的所有功能,统一身份认证,统一基础数据管理,弱化微服务开发难度
- GigaDevice.GD32F4xx-DFP.2.1.0 器件安装包
- 智慧校园数字孪生,三维可视化
- 多种土地使用类型图像分类数据集【已标注,约30,000张数据】
- 3.0(1).docx
- 国产文本编辑器:EverEdit用户手册 1.1.0